You have several transportation options to get from Jomtien (Pattaya area) to Bangkok: Bus (affordable, frequent), Van (shared, relatively fast), Taxi/Private Car (fastest, most comfortable, most expensive), Train (alternative option), and potentially Flight (less common for this short distance, likely from nearby U-Tapao/Rayong airport).
Travel time between Jomtien and Bangkok varies by transport mode. By car or taxi (like Bangkok Taxi 24), it can be as fast as 1 hour 40 minutes, typically ranging up to 3 hours 30 minutes. Buses usually take 2-3 hours, depending on traffic and your specific destination in Bangkok. The distance between Jomtien (Pattaya area) and Bangkok depends on how it's measured. The approximate road distance, particularly for bus routes, is often cited around 150 km. A more direct car route or the air distance might be closer to 105 km (approx. 65 miles) or 86 km (54 miles), depending on the exact start and end points for your Jomtien to Bangkok journey.
The cost for traveling from Jomtien to Bangkok varies significantly by transport type. Bus tickets are generally the most affordable, ranging from $5 to $19 USD (approx. 150-300 THB), with operators like Roong Reuang Coach offering fares as low as $5. Vans cost around $7-$12. Train tickets are about $7. Private taxis are the most expensive, ranging from $46 up to $317, with services like Bangkok Taxi 24 starting around $51 USD. Flights, if available for the Jomtien to Bangkok route, were cited around $228.
The fastest way to travel from Jomtien to Bangkok is typically by private car or taxi. Services like those offered by Bangkok Taxi 24 can complete the journey in approximately 1 hour and 40 minutes, though actual time depends on traffic conditions between Jomtien and Bangkok.
The cheapest way to travel between Jomtien and Bangkok is generally by bus. You can find bus tickets for as low as $5 USD (approx. 150 THB). Operators such as Roong Reuang Coach are known for offering these budget-friendly fares for the Jomtien to Bangkok route.

There are numerous daily trips between Jomtien and Bangkok across different transport modes. Buses run very frequently, with approximately 43 trips daily, operating from around 04:30 to 21:00. Vans also offer many departures, estimated at 21 per day. Taxis are available for booking anytime for the Jomtien to Bangkok route. Train and flight options are generally less frequent.

The number of stops during the journey from Jomtien to Bangkok depends on the service. Direct bus services (e.g., those going directly to Bangkok airports) or private taxis may have no intermediate stops. Other bus services might include 0-2 scheduled stops along the route. If you hire a private taxi for your trip from Jomtien to Bangkok, you can usually arrange for custom stops.
Buses traveling the route from Jomtien to Bangkok typically feature air conditioning as standard. Common amenities often include reclining seats. Many services, particularly first-class or VIP buses, provide an onboard toilet. Some premium services might also offer complimentary snacks or water during the trip from Jomtien to Bangkok. Wi-Fi might be available on higher-class buses.
Choosing the best transport from Jomtien to Bangkok depends on your priorities. For the lowest cost, buses are recommended (frequent, affordable; consider higher-class buses for more comfort). For the fastest travel time and highest convenience, taxis or private cars are ideal, although they are the most expensive option (good for custom routes, use GPS). Vans offer a balance, being relatively fast like taxis but shared and more affordable. Trains are another alternative for the Jomtien to Bangkok trip (consider travel class for comfort).
